  4. Took about a month to finish all box stock and rustoleum paints as well as testors to airbrush small parts, very hard kit in terms of fitment I did not glue the cab or anything not many parts had mounting points so I made them with a small drill and copper wire. The basket brackets would not glue on otherwise. Decals are done letter by letter I did my best but I know they are a little twisty. The smaller phila decals are custom and fall apart in seconds but I still got them on.  Perhaps it's not entirely historicaly accurate, I certainly wish there was more fire truck choices. The German ones are gonna be my next build.
